Economic Survey: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man is going to present the country's general budget on 1 February. But before the presentation of the general budget, the Economic Survey is also presented in the Parliament. In such a situation, the question arises that what is this economic survey and why is it presented before the budget. Economic Survey is a very important document to understand the economic condition of the country. Let's know everything about it.
What would have been an economic survey?
Economic survey is like an accounting. For example, take a middle class Indian family. Generally, the middle class family keeps account of each and every item of their house in a register. At the end of the year, the head of the family sees how much was spent and how much was saved. On the basis of that, he prepares for the next year's home expenses. Economic Survey is also similar. In which the framework for preparing the next year's budget is decided on the basis of the accounts of the country's last one year.
Why is Economic Survey important?
Economic Survey 2022 is an annual account of the economic development of the country in a year. On the basis of which it is estimated that how the country's economy was in the last one year. On which fronts were there gains and where were losses. On the basis of this Economic Survey, it is decided that what kind of possibilities exist in the country's economy in the coming year. Suggestions are also given to the government on the basis of economic survey, but whether to implement them or not, it is the responsibility of the government. This is the reason why the Economic Survey is placed on the table of the Parliament just before the presentation of the budget.
Economic Survey makes forecast
Economic Survey not only predicts the country's economy, but also estimates what will be expensive and what can be cheap on the basis of last year. For example, along with treasury, broad prospect, product, inflation rate, information about all the economic activities of the country related to the economy is available from the Economic Survey. Due to which it is estimated whether there will be recession or boom in the economy in the coming year, then further process is done on the basis of this.
When was the Economic Survey prepared for the first time
The first Economic Survey of the country was introduced between 1950-51. The special thing is that till 1964 the Economic Survey was presented along with the general budget of the country. But then it is being presented a day before the budget. To a large extent, it is also estimated from the Economic Survey that what is going to come in the budget.
